Surfers Paradise YHA - Gold Coast

22A/70 Seaworld Drive, Main Beach , 4217 , Gold Coast , ,Australia

Address: 22A/70 Seaworld Drive, Main Beach , 4217 , Gold Coast , Australia
Phone:
Web:
GPS Lat: -27.968695 , Lon: 153.427322

Map